    <title>1987 (7) TMI 444 - CEGAT, NEW DELHI</title>
    <link>https://www.taxtmi.com/caselaws?id=74716</link>
    <description>PVC-laminated jute fabric was held classifiable as laminated textile fabrics under Item 22-B rather than as jute manufactures under Item 22-A because the later tariff entry specifically covered textile fabrics impregnated, coated or laminated. The earlier exemption notifications did not govern the later tariff position, having been issued before Item 22-B was introduced and amended. The classification in favour of the Revenue was sustained.</description>
